Recruiting in Tight Times

In recruiting terms, a labour market is tight when it is difficult to find the right candidate for a position. And right now the Australian labour market is as tight as it gets.

With unemployment rates at historic lows throughout Australia, many healthcare providers are having a tough time finding the talent they need. With fewer people actively seeking out jobs, filling vacant positions has become more difficult.

Meanwhile, the cost of finding and keeping the right employee is going up. A recent report found 73 percent of Australian employers are paying significantly more in staffing costs than they were a year ago - making successful recruiting all the more vital to Australian organizations.

Another distinct advantage that healthcare recruiters offer in a tight market is in the creation of your job listing or advertisement. Because they have recruited countless healthcare professionals in the past, they know what words work. The wording of your ad is just as important as its placement - make sure your ad grabs the attention of the type of people who want to attract.

When writing your job listing, remember to make it:

  • Informative – make sure potential candidates have an understanding of what position they are applying for and if they are qualified.
  • Enticing – people have to want to apply for the job, do your best to make the position sound appealing (without stretching the truth of course).
  • Clear – be sure to include concise instructions on how and where to apply, as well as your closing dates and any other important criteria.
